You better check the wheelbase, my eb4 xsara body is shorter then the shortest wheel base I could run, front caster set to max, rear pbs both spacers behind the arm, I ended up milling the arm so that I could but another thin spacer, the pbs has 2 types thick and thin, ones like 3mm, the other is 4, I milled it so that I could run 3 thin spacers behind the arm, just to get the wheelbase close to fit the body, I gotta get a new camera, but I am not sure what the wheel base is on the subaru, or what it is on a stock gtp, not a 2, I have the older blue chassis gtp not sure what the 2 is wheel base wise?
Width wise, I already had my car narrowed, so I ended up adjusting the suspension wider and my tires still tuck, I am may put stock length arms back on and check,I have some somewhere gotta see if I can find them, I really wish someone would come out with the current sti hatch?

The ultras havent changed in years, a ultra is a ultra , I have a older blue chassis one, I bought the 4mm cnc chassis they had years ago, so I wanted to use that chassis, and I didnt care for the rc-monster 2 bolt mount, to close together for my taste,and I like the ofna style ,but the spacing is different,and I wasnt about to ghetto my cnc chassis, plus the ofna one wont let you run larger the a 25t pinoin?unless you run a smaller spur? so I made my own to fit the narrower bolt spacing plus use a 3 bolt down, and made mine able to slide the motor over 40% more.
Oh and the 2k wasnt for parts, it was for the mill I bought and everything I needed with it, that does not include material time, oh lots and lots of time, plus anything like a esc or motor,.
